Hehe, I've been thinking of translating it for ages, I just need a few more hours every day "She" sounds good Its hard to describe a sound, it works best with lots of overdrive, the pickups are kind of "dirty" sounding (very hot pickups) a little trebly maybe but the best neck pickup sound I have ever played with. The gotog truss is very easy to install and works well, just route a 11x9 mm slot for it and drop it in with the "open" side down. Can't wait to see it... The inlay is lasercut, laserengraved (with a little help with the dremel) in the fretboard

  8. I do all my fretboards with a laser, inlays and all. You have to clean the inlay "cavities" with a dremel or something, and saw the fretslots to get the right width/depth. The laser I use works lika any windows printer, just draw the board in corel and print.
